The Middleby Corporation, through its subsidiaries, engages in the design, manufacture, and sale of commercial foodservice and food processing equipment in the United States, Canada, Asia, Europe, the Middle East, and Latin America. The company has a P/E ratio of 22.4, above the average industrial industry P/E ratio of 21.5 and above the S&P 500 P/E ratio of 17.7.
